Grade A, and why
bio-database-evidence sc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 13d ago.
A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.
Nothing flagged
None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.

Bio Database Evidence
Use This Skill For
Use this skill when the main task is biological database lookup, annotation, or evidence gathering across one or more biological sources:
- Gene annotation, identifiers, RefSeq, Ensembl IDs, orthologs, VEP, GO, and genomic coordinates.
- Variant clinical significance, VUS interpretation support, ClinVar review status, cancer mutations, and COSMIC evidence.
- GWAS Catalog trait associations, rs IDs, p-values, summary statistics, and genetic epidemiology evidence.
- Pathway mapping, ID conversion, KEGG pathways, Reactome enrichment, disease pathways, and pathway evidence.
- Target-disease association evidence, tractability, safety, known drugs, and Open Targets evidence.
- Protein structure evidence from AlphaFold DB or RCSB PDB, including UniProt IDs, mmCIF/PDB downloads, pLDDT, PAE, and structure metadata.
- Protein-protein interaction evidence, STRING networks, hub proteins, and enrichment evidence.
- Reference single-cell data lookup from CELLxGENE Census when the user asks for census metadata or expression data, not full downstream analysis.
- Cross-database biological ID mapping and evidence tables across multiple resources.
Do Not Use This Skill For
- Single-cell RNA-seq analysis, clustering, UMAP, marker genes, cell annotation, AnnData/h5ad container editing, or scVI/scANVI batch-correction planning. Use
scanpy. - Bulk RNA-seq differential expression. Use
pydeseq2. - BAM, SAM, CRAM, VCF, pileup, coverage, or region extraction as a primary file-processing task.
- deepTools signal-track processing and heatmaps.
- Protein language models, embeddings, inverse folding, or protein-design workflows.
- Constraint-based metabolic modeling, FBA, or metabolic-engineering simulation.
- BED/genomic interval embeddings, genomic-region ML, or gene regulatory network inference.
- FCS or flow-cytometry file parsing.
Workflow
- Identify the biological entity type: gene, transcript, variant, pathway, target, protein structure, protein interaction, trait association, or reference cell population.
- Pick the narrowest source that answers the evidence question.
- Preserve source names, query terms, access dates, identifiers, and API caveats in the result.
- Return evidence in a table when comparing multiple sources.
- State when authentication, license, rate limits, or non-public access restricts a source.
